The Paramar System is a system of Imperial space, located in the northern reaches of the Segmentum Solar.[1]


Overview

It is a trinary star system with great, albeit difficult to access, mineral wealth. In addition, it lies in an unusually stable Warp-synchronous location.[1]

The most significant parts of the system are the planet Paramar V, a Mechanicum world that was given over to promethium refining and the storage of weapons and munitions, and the Pharaeon of Paramar, a moon of Paramar XXI that served as a depot for the Imperialis Armada.[1]

History

The Paramar System was first identified during the Great Crusade, having been recorded in the Carta Imperialis in 803.M30 by the Rogue Trader Hel DeAniasie. Not long afterwards, the system became a waypoint for the Crusade; it quickly expanded from an automated Mechanicum outpost to a refuelling and resupply depot for Imperial Expeditionary Fleets, allowing the Imperium to expand from the Segmentum Solar into the Segmentum Obscurus.[1]

Following the Crisis of the Hungering Gyre in 891.M30, the system was made part of the domain of the Forge World Gryphonne IV.[1]

Celestial Objects

The Paramar System possesses three suns with 37 recorded major bodies orbiting them.[1]
